Payment Relief for Tax Owed

The IRS and US Treasury have announced a 90 day reprieve on taxes owed for individuals and corporations. Individual and pass through entity filers will have a 90 day delay in paying income taxes owed, up to $1 million. Corporate filers will have the same 90 days but for $10 million. During that time period, Taxpayers will not be subject to interest and penalties. This guidance is for federal returns only. Individuals are still encouraged to file by April 15th. We will keep you updated as guidance changes for either federal or state returns.
